Dozens of honey bees found on the snow around the hives. Many more -- probably a few hundred,
were scattered over the snow in an swath that seemed to go to the east for about 30-40 meters.
Temperature was about -12C (10F). Strong sunlight.
A small flock of chickadees in the cedar bushes behind we seen diving down to grab something
off the snow from time to time. We didn't get a good enough look to see what they were taking,
but suspect it was the bees.
